Wir haben ein echtes Zwickl vor uns, also ein unfiltriert abgefülltes Spezial. Liebe Biergenießer: Genau so sollte ein Zwickl aussehen, mit seidigem Schimmer, sogenannter Opaleszenz (und nicht etwa „blickdicht“)!
Im herrlichen Duft finden sich fruchtige Töne, sie erinnern an Zuckermelone und grüne Birne. Erfrischender Antrunk in dem ebenfalls die Fruchtnoten überwiegen; etwas Quitte und Sternfrucht. Die schöne Fülle am Gaumen begleitet uns bis in den opulent fruchtsüßen Nachtrunk.
Die lange Reifezeit (7 – 8 Wochen) macht dieses Bier besonders bekömmlich. Das Raschhofer Zwickl bleibt vollkommen unbehandelt und wird direkt vom Lagertank abgefüllt. So enthält es noch die Vitamine der Hefe. Vor dem Genuss sollte Fass gewendet bzw. die Flasche behutsam aufgeschüttelt werden.
